The Fraud Behind Election Fraud

An interactive statistical analysis debunking claims of electronic vote manipulation in the 2024 US election. Using Clark County, Nevada data, this project demonstrates how misunderstandings of basic statistics, can lead to false conclusions about election integrity, especially when presented in a deceptive manner.

Features interactive visualizations, statistical simulations, and a thorough breakdown of methodological errors in conspiracy theories.
